The question in this case is whether the priority date of the F-4 petitioner is current. If current and the beneficiary is in the US on a legal visa, he may be allowed to adjust status with U.S.C.I.S. depending on the circumstances. However, the waiting period of an F-4 petition to become available is 13+ years and U.S.C.I.S. does not allow an individual to remain in the US just based upon a visa petition being filed or approved unless the priority date is available for immigrant visa issuance.
